Ingredients
- 400g Bramley apples
- Juice of ½ lemon
- 1½ tbsp caster sugar
- A little butter and salt, to serve
Method
- 1. Peel and dice the apples. Put in a small pan with the juice of ½ lemon, 2 tbsp water and 1½ tbsp caster sugar. Heat gently until the apples are really soft, then squash with a spoon. Add a little butter and salt to serve.
Chef's tip
Try spicing up the sauce with a pinch of ground cloves or a little allspice.
